Write the balanced nuclear equation for each of the following: (5.2)

a. When two oxygen-16 atoms collide, one of the products is an alpha particle.

b. When californium- 249 is bombarded by oxygen- 18 , a new element, seaborgium-263, and four neutrons are produced.

c. Radon- 222 undergoes alpha decay.

d. An atom of strontium- 80 emits a positron.

1Step 1- Given Information

Both mass numbers and atomic numbers are balanced to balance the nuclear reaction. That is, the sum of the mass number and atomic number of the reactants is equal to the product.

2Step 2- Given explanation (part a)

a.

Use the following steps to determine the product.

O816+O816?+He24

Unknown product mass number:

16+16=A-4

     A=28

Atomic number of unknown product: 

   8+8=Z-2

    Z=14

So the product is  1428Si, and the complete reaction is:

 O816+O816Si1428+He24
